Technical Specifications

Parameter NameValue
TypeParameter
Package / Case D
Surface MountYES
Number of Pins 14
Weight 129.387224mg
PackagingRail/Tube
JESD-609 Code e4
Pbfree Code yes
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L) 2 (1 Year)
Number of Terminations 14
ECCN Code EAR99
Max Operating Temperature85°C
Min Operating Temperature -40°C
Subcategory Operational Amplifier
Technology BIPOLAR
Terminal FormGULL WING
Peak Reflow Temperature (Cel) 260
Number of Functions 2
Pin Count14
Operating Supply Voltage9V
Number of Elements 2
Max Supply Voltage12V
Min Supply Voltage5V
Operating Supply Current 11mA
Slew Rate1800 V/μs
Amplifier Type OPERATIONAL AMPLIFIER
Common Mode Rejection Ratio 58 dB
Current - Input Bias 12μA
Output Current per Channel 190mA
Input Offset Voltage (Vos) 4.5mV
Bandwidth 300MHz
Gain Bandwidth Product250MHz
Voltage Gain 63dB
Power Supply Rejection Ratio (PSRR) 72dB
Settling Time8 ns
Max Dual Supply Voltage6V
-3db Bandwidth 500MHz
Min Dual Supply Voltage 2.5V
Dual Supply Voltage 5V
Max I/O Voltage 4.5mV
Height 1.58mm
Length 8.65mm
Width 3.91mm
Radiation HardeningNo
RoHS StatusRoHS Compliant
